On Sat, 9 Sep 2017, Steve Johnson wrote:

> Part of that problem was probably electronic, not software.   Many of 
> the early terminals were half-duplex.  The normal mode was that the 
> terminal typed what came over the line, and the keyboard was locked.  If 
> you wanted to let the terminal send data, you needed to send a control 
> character to unlock the keyboard, and then another one to lock it when 
> you wanted to send data again.
